Output 663e002a682a7a800029e3a2b6007bdc1f4366d56f458e34ed3c8f6efd18d13f:6

value
103139
script pubkey
OP_0 OP_PUSHBYTES_20 31dedbc061eb32ad60c4521707a7f30bce812a8d
address
bc1qx80dhsrpave26cxy2gts0flnp08gz25dzyfdex
transaction
663e002a682a7a800029e3a2b6007bdc1f4366d56f458e34ed3c8f6efd18d13f
spent
true